New research from DuPont reveals huge demand for meat alternatives from consumers in key Asia markets
SINGAPORE, Dec. 16, 2020 – DuPont Nutrition & Biosciences (NYSE: DuPont) and IPSOS, a global market research firm published a new research study that shows a significant increase in demand for plant-based meat alternatives in key Asia Pacific (APAC) markets.
In China and Thailand, demand for plant-based meat is forecasted to increase by 200 percent over the next five years, driven by consumer values around health, taste and sustainability. This trend is replicated more widely across the entire APAC region, with an expected 25 percent increase in the market size for plant-based meat alternatives – to $1.7 billion USD – over the next five years.

Asia Pacific is home to 4.3 billion people, making up 60 percent of the world’s population, with over a third (36 percent) of consumers already consuming low or no meat diets. In 2020, the value for plant-based meat is forecasted to increase by 7.4 percent, compared to the previous year. As consumer priorities shift towards health and sustainability, this upward trend is set to continue.
